So i got a new replacement bionic since i had so many issues with first one. So far 2nd one seems good. First one was set up IN the verizon store for me...they transferred all of my pics from old HTC incredible to bionic. That bionic was returned to store. New bionic was sent via fed ex & I activated myself. Come to find out...all my pics are on my droid incred. But i cannot figure out how to get them to bionic. Theyre stored ON THE PHONE not the SD card. I hooked incred to computer & htc sync comes up...i sync with computer trying to move pics to pc but then once phone is unplugged theyre not there! How on earth are the verizon store employees able to get pics from phone to phone so easily?!

Use an app call Astro that will let you view you files on your Incredible 1. You're pictures should be in the 'root' directory under DCIM. There may be random pictures elsewhere, so check all you folders twice. The Incredible 1 was the only Android device that the camera app did not default to saving to the SD card. Users had to go into the menu of the camera app and change it, so most phones were not changed.
